Ownership & management
Remarks FAA
- OWNER DESIRES ARPT BE CHARTED.
- RWY 17/35 LCTD ON A PLATEAU; SHARP DROP OFF NEAR BOTH RWY ENDS.
- NO WINTER MAINT; USE AT OWN RISK.
- CTN: PSBL LRG WILDLIFE ON OR INVOF RWY.
- RWY SFC ROUGH DUE TO HVY LIVESTOCK TFC ON RWY.

About 0ID
W E Ranch Airport (0ID) is an airport in Thatcher, ID, at 5,075 ft MSL. It has 1 runway, the longest 1,350 ft, with no control tower (pilot-controlled).
